Search Engine Optimization, or SEO, refers to the process of optimizing a website or online content to improve its visibility and ranking in search engine results pages (SERPs). The goal of SEO is to increase organic, or unpaid, traffic to a website from search engines like Google, Bing, and Yahoo.
Search Engine Optimization (SEO) is the practice of optimizing a website or digital content to increase its visibility and rank higher in search engine results pages (SERPs). SEO involves various techniques, including keyword research, on-page optimization, link building, and technical optimization, that improve the relevance and quality of content for search engines. By optimizing a website for SEO, businesses can increase their organic traffic, attract more potential customers, and improve their online presence. SEO is an ongoing process that requires continuous monitoring, analysis, and optimization to stay ahead of competitors and search engine algorithm updates. A well-executed SEO strategy can lead to a significant return on investment, as it drives targeted traffic and increases the chances of conversions. With the importance of online visibility and the increasing number of competitors, SEO has become a critical aspect of digital marketing for businesses of all sizes.
